any [judge etc.] worth salt

any [judge/lawyer/teacher etc.] worth their salt

any judge, lawyer, teacher etc. who is good at their job Any lawyer worth his salt should be aware of the latest changes in taxation. No judge worth her salt would attempt to influence the jury.
See also: any, salt, worth